آموزش کار با سلسله مراتب در SQL Server

Working with Hierarchies in SQL Server

نکته: آ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یوها:
توضیحات دوره: در این دوره یاد می گیرید که با داده های سلسله مراتبی در SQL Server با استفاده از hierarchyid کار کنید. شما بر تکنیک های ایجاد، پرس و جو، بهینه سازی و پیمایش موثر سلسله مراتب مسلط خواهید شد. درک نوع داده HierarchyID در SQL Server برای مدیریت ساختارهای داده سلسله مراتبی یا تو در تو، افزایش کارایی و عملکرد پرس و جوهای پایگاه داده بسیار مهم است. در این دوره آموزشی، کار با سلسله مراتب در SQL Server، توانایی کار با داده های سلسله مراتبی در SQL Server را به دست خواهید آورد. ابتدا، اهمیت، ساختار و نمایش سلسله مراتب را با تمرکز بر نوع داده سلسله مراتبی درک خواهید کرد. با ایجاد سلسله مراتب، پرس و جو در آنها، و مقایسه hierarchyid با سایر مدل های سلسله مراتبی، پایه ای قوی به دست خواهید آورد. در مرحله بعد، ویژگی‌های گره مانند عمق، وسعت و موقعیت را کاوش می‌کنید و یاد می‌گیرید که فرزندان را بیابید، گره‌ها را اصلاح کنید، و عمق و وسعت را از طریق تمرین‌های عملی محاسبه کنید. در نهایت، شما یاد خواهید گرفت که عملکرد را با ایندکس ها بهبود ببخشید، یکپارچگی را با محرک ها اعمال کنید و در مورد بهترین شیوه ها در سلسله مراتب SQL Server بحث کنید. در پایان این دوره، شما هم درک نظری و هم تجربه عملی با داده های سلسله مراتبی در SQL Server خواهید داشت. شما آماده خواهید بود تا با به کارگیری این مهارت ها در سناریوهای دنیای واقعی، روابط پیچیده داده را به طور موثر مدیریت کنید.

سرفصل ها و درس ها

بررسی اجمالی دوره Course Overview

  • بررسی اجمالی دوره Course Overview

مروری بر سلسله مراتب در SQL Server Overview of Hierarchies in SQL Server

  • معرفی Introduction

  • مروری بر سلسله مراتب در SQL Server Overview of Hierarchies in SQL Server

  • نسخه ی نمایشی: ایجاد و اضافه کردن یک سلسله مراتب با استفاده از hierarchyid Demo: Create and Add a Hierarchy Using hierarchyid

  • Hierarchyid را با سایر مدل های سلسله مراتبی مقایسه کنید Compare hierarchyid to Other Hierarchy Models

  • نسخه ی نمایشی: سلسله مراتب را با لیست های مجاورت مقایسه کنید Demo: Compare hierarchyid to Adjacency Lists

  • بهترین شیوه ها Best Practices

کار با گره ها در یک سلسله مراتب Working with Nodes in a Hierarchy

  • معرفی Introduction

  • ویژگی های گره ها Properties of Nodes

  • نسخه ی نمایشی: یافتن فرزندان با عبور از سلسله مراتب Demo: Finding Descendants by Traversing the Hierarchy

  • نسخه ی نمایشی: درج گره ها در یک سلسله مراتب موجود Demo: Inserting Nodes in an Existing Hierarchy

  • نسخه ی نمایشی: حرکت گره ها در یک سلسله مراتب موجود Demo: Moving Nodes in an Existing Hierarchy

  • نسخه ی نمایشی: عمق و عرض را با CTE های بازگشتی محاسبه کنید Demo: Calculate Depth and Breadth with Recursive CTEs

  • بهترین شیوه ها Best Practices

بهینه سازی عملکرد و حفظ یکپارچگی Optimizing Performance and Maintaining Integrity

  • معرفی Introduction

  • نسخه ی نمایشی: بهینه سازی عملکرد با شاخص ها Demo: Optimizing Performance with Indexes

  • نسخه ی نمایشی: حفظ یکپارچگی با محرک ها Demo: Maintaining Integrity with Triggers

  • بهترین شیوه ها Best Practices

نمایش نظرات

آموزش کار با سلسله مراتب در SQL Server
جزییات دوره
0h 49m
18
Pluralsight (پلورال سایت) Pluralsight (پلورال سایت)
(آخرین آپدیت)
از 5
دارد
دارد
دارد
Pinal Dave
جهت دریافت آخرین اخبار و آپدیت ها در کانال تلگرام عضو شوید.

Google Chrome Browser

Internet Download Manager

Pot Player

Winrar

Pinal Dave Pinal Dave

Pinal Dave یک متخصص تنظیم عملکرد SQL سرور و یک مشاور مستقل است. وی 11 کتاب پایگاه داده SQL Server ، 25 دوره Pluralsight را تألیف کرده و بیش از 5000 مقاله در زمینه فناوری پایگاه داده در وبلاگ خود در https://blog.sqlauthority.com نوشته است. وی همراه با 16 سال تجربه عملی ، دارای مدرک کارشناسی ارشد علوم و تعدادی گواهینامه پایگاه داده است.